The Fennwick telemetry agent compresses payloads with our vendored Zarnel codec before upload. Because the codec handles untrusted field data, every release is built hermetically on the Corval build farm, and the resulting attestation binds source revision, compiler version, and codec flags. Reviewers should confirm the attestation chain terminates at the Fennwick signing root and that no unattested compression library appears in the dependency graph. The current attested build token appears below.

pipeline stamp: htk31_f769b577b3028a4e9958e5bb8d1259a

## Webhooks 101: Retries

Welcome aboard! Quick heads-up on how Fernwick delivers webhooks: if your endpoint returns anything other than a 2xx, we retry with exponential backoff — roughly 1m, 5m, 30m, then hourly up to 24 hours. Duplicate deliveries can happen, so make your handlers idempotent (check the event ID before acting). After 24 hours we drop the event and flag it in the dashboard. If you get stuck or want a test event replayed, ping the integrations crew at the address below.

escalation mailbox, yajeg-bageg: quenax.olidor@lumiccorp.internal

Alert: SplitGate assignment latency breach. The SplitGate service, which assigns users to A/B experiment arms for all Vendriel storefronts, is exceeding its 50 ms p99 budget. When this fires during a release window, hold the rollout: slow assignments cause clients to fall back to control, which silently skews experiment results and can invalidate the week's data. Verify whether the latest deploy correlates, and if so, roll back first. Mitigation steps are on the page below.

dashboard of kajep-tajog = https://harbor.tolvaqworks.example/pipeline/run/dash/pipeline/228e278bbf9b3bc2

## Further Reading

Telemetry payloads from Skerrit agents are compressed with a custom dictionary scheme before upload. Support should not decompress payloads manually; use the inspection tool. Common tickets: truncated payloads (usually a dictionary version mismatch) and oversized batches (agent older than v3.2). Escalate anything involving corrupt dictionaries. Dictionary version matrix, tooling instructions, and known compression failure modes are documented on the internal page linked here.

wiki page, tagef-bajog: https://grafana.nelvrocorp.corp/projects/pages/display/fa238a928afe